Stress-Free Event Management: Tips and Techniques
Planning an event is often a rewarding experience, but it rarely involves considerable stress. However, by adopting some effective tips and techniques, you can substantially minimize the pressure and 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ience for both yourself and your guests.
One crucial aspect of stress-free event management is meticulous planning. Formulate a detailed timeline, allocate tasks to reliable individuals, and share information concisely with all involved parties.
Furthermore, stay organized by using tools like spreadsheets or project management software to track progress, deadlines, and costs.
Another key ingredient is delegation. Don't strive to do everything yourself! Determine tasks that can be assigned to capable individuals.
Remember, a well-organized and prepared event manager always experiences less stress.
